Clinical Translation Partnerships (CTP) was
established in 2010 to help the cellular therapy
community translate its research into viable
clinical therapies, by utilising NHSBT's massive
skills and expertise in managing the entire value
chain from consent, procurement, manufacturing and
the cold supply chain to patients.As part of
NHSBT, CTP has a unique access to the NHS and is
based on over 60 years experience in managing the
repeatable delivery of viable cell and organ based
therapies. Building on the experience gained in
manufacturing, processing and logistical delivery of
over 2 million units every year, we are a powerful
partner to translate your cellular therapies into
viable clinical therapies.
CTP sits within
the National Blood Service and utilises the ATMP
viable infrastructure of national HTA and MHRA
licensed GMP facilities, and the inherent skills of
its production scientists to work with organisations
(academic, clinical, or commercial). Acting as a
manufacturing and supply chain expert who can aid in
the translation of research into viable clinical
therapies.
CTP is therefore able to offer
services ranging from process optimisation and
conversion into GMP systems, through to clinical
production and logistical delivery to patients.
CTP has access to over 27 HTA and MHRA regulated
clean rooms, throughout the UK that delivers
clinical treatments on a daily basis. This enables
access to scientists, production professionals, and
clinicians who can use their combined knowledge and
expertise to:
- Optimise processes
- Translate into GMP
- Manage logistical processes
- Consult on how best to deliver treatment to patients
